Output d21d42bbe283fe0e9e5f8931a1aee6c2e62bc337199fea90a95148774cd88d43:0

value
3092000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f408b64160fbe9a664b9bcb9446baf286153024c OP_EQUAL
address
3PwMEfbUsvKieQtDu2Kwm1Sf1HH8T1VCYQ
transaction
d21d42bbe283fe0e9e5f8931a1aee6c2e62bc337199fea90a95148774cd88d43
spent
true